Mercyhealth Partners with Vitea to Advance AI Governance and Safety in Healthcare

Mercyhealth Partners with Vitea for Responsible AI Integration



Introduction
In a significant move towards enhancing healthcare delivery through technology, Mercyhealth has announced its partnership with Vitea, an innovative AI governance platform tailored for the healthcare sector. This collaboration aims to enable comprehensive oversight of AI applications, ensuring they are both visible and compliant with hospital policies and regulatory requirements.

Key Features of Vitea’s Governance Platform
Vitea's system is designed to offer superior visibility into every AI application in use, allowing Mercyhealth to oversee and manage these technologies effectively. The platform includes over 100 pre-configured healthcare-specific policies that are enforced in real-time, ensuring that any deviations from standards are caught early in the process.

Ali Olia, the Chief Information Officer at Mercyhealth, stressed the importance of a tailored approach to governance. He pointed out that traditional security measures are inadequate for addressing the unique risks posed by AI systems, which often operate in unpredictable ways. His commitment to high operational standards aligns perfectly with Vitea’s capabilities, providing Mercyhealth with the infrastructure needed to mitigate AI-related risks and maintain a focus on patient care.

A Broader Shift in Healthcare AI Adoption
The partnership with Vitea signifies a broader trend among healthcare systems to prioritize governance in their AI strategies. Instead of treating compliance as an afterthought, organizations are now recognizing that it is vital to embed governance into the core of AI implementation. This shift is rooted in the understanding that building trust within clinical environments requires transparency and accountability, especially when patient care is directly affected by technological innovations.

Jeremy Colson, Chief Data and Analytics Officer at Mercyhealth, echoed this sentiment, emphasizing the necessity for oversight when patient care is at stake. He noted that with Vitea, Mercyhealth has a precise view of AI application performances and the ability to enforce policy uniformly across its multi-site operations. Such governance ensures data integrity is maintained, which is critical as the organization navigates various AI regulations across different states.
